What Does an a Auto Insurance Agent in Swansea Cost?
The average cost of auto insurance in Illinois is around $1,300 per year for full coverage, but rates in Swansea may vary based on factors like age, driving history, and vehicle. Minimum liability policies can cost as low as $500 per year. An agent can provide quotes from multiple companies to help you find competitive pricing. About auto insurance agents in Swansea
Auto insurance agents in Swansea, Illinois help drivers find coverage that meets state requirements and personal needs. Illinois law mandates minimum liability limits of $25,000 per person and $50,000 per accident for bodily injury. A local agent can explain these laws and help you compare policies from multiple carriers.
Frequently Asked Questions
What are the minimum auto insurance requirements in Illinois?
Illinois requires liability coverage of at least $25,000 per person for bodily injury, $50,000 per accident for bodily injury, and $20,000 per accident for property damage. Uninsured motorist coverage is also required at the same limits.

Can an auto insurance agent help me save money on my policy?
Yes, an agent can review your driving record, vehicle type, and available discounts to find lower rates. They can also adjust deductibles and coverage limits to fit your budget while meeting Illinois legal requirements.
